Report: Chelsea could now move for 'special' Aston Villa player if they fail to secure £55m transfer

Chelsea and Aston Villa have been two of the biggest spenders in the Premier League this summer, and both sides look set to continue with making transfers.

The west London side remain in the hunt for a striker, with Chelsea working to sign Napoli’s £55m-rated striker Victor Osimhen, whilst Villa lead the chase to sign Liverpool defender Joe Gomez, who could join Unai Emery’s side before Friday’s deadline.

Given how much both teams have already spent this summer, some departures are also likely to be in order, with Villa already linked with a move for Raheem Sterling as Chelsea look to offload the England international.

And the Blues could now move for a Villa star if they fail to bring Osimhen to Stamford Bridge.

Chelsea could revive interest in Aston Villa’s Jhon Duran

According to GiveMeSport, Chelsea could return to Villa for Jhon Duran if Enzo Maresca’s side miss out on signing Osimhen, with the report stating that the Colombia international is open to leaving Villa Park for the two-time UEFA Champions League winners.

Lauded by Emery as a ‘special’ talent via Bein Sports, West Ham have also moved for Duran this summer, with the South American prospect highly expected to leave Villa amid so much interest from Premier League teams.

Having weathered the storm, though, it had looked like Duran will remain with Villa heading out of the summer transfer window, yet Chelsea could again derail such plans if their bid for Osimhen falls though in the coming days.

Indeed, the transfer saga revolving around Duran has been a long and arduous one, and for Villa fans, they will be happy to see the back of this window given how much speculation has surrounded the 20-year-old attacker.

Villa need to do all they can to keep Duran this week

With Duran taking the no. shirt and scoring in Villa’s Premier League opener against West Ham, it’s safe to say that the attacker looks happy at Villa Park under Emery.

Yet with Chelsea threatening to reignite their interest in the former Chicago Fire star, Villa must do all they can to keep hold of Duran this week, with the transfer window just a few days away from closing.

With the UEFA Champions League coming up next month for Villa, Duran should want to stay and fight for his spot ahead of Europe’s biggest club competition, and the chaos surrounding Chelsea should put the youngster off a move already this summer.
